Legendary Australian leg-spinner Shane Warne died of suspected heart attack today, reports say.
Warne, with 708 scalps, is the second highest wicket-taker in Tests, behind only Sri Lanka's Muthiah Muralitharan (800).
“Shane was found unresponsive in his villa and despite the best efforts of medical staff, he could not be revived,” Warne’s management confirmed in a statement.
